Hollywood Wax Museum
Category:
Museums & Galleries
6767 Hollywood Blvd
Los Angeles,
California 90028
(323) 462-8860
The Hollywood wax museum has displays of scenes from your favorite movies with wax figures. ...
More
The Hollywood wax museum has displays of scenes from your favorite movies with wax figures. Although some of the wax figures do not look as life like as some of the others the museum is still worth taking a look at. The museum has late hours (they are open until 1 am) so it is a good place to go to end the day. You can buy a combination ticket that also gives you admission to the Guiness Book of World Records Museum that is across the street.

Los Angeles Live Steamers is a club that maintains a minature train track near LA's Griffith Park....
More
Los Angeles Live Steamers is a club that maintains a minature train track near LA's Griffith Park. The club runs member built trains on a track on Saturdays, and allows the public to come ride these little trains. This is a great experience -- for both the train buff and the kids. Sit on knee high trains around a track, lots of different trains, and very enthusiastic members. Highly recommended.

Magic Castle
Category:
Night Clubs
7001 Franklin Ave
Los Angeles,
California 90028
(323) 851-3313
After giving your name to the hostess at the front, you are given a passwoord which you must give...
More
After giving your name to the hostess at the front, you are given a passwoord which you must give to the stuffed bird sitting on a bookcase, which then opens. Then you enter the famous magic castle, a club for magicians and millionaire malcontents. there is a bar, a lounge with a piano that takes requests -- though there is no player-- apparently it's a ghost, and a dungeon downstairs. Thhere are a few close-up theatres and one grand stage where all forms of prestidigitation occur. If you can manage to get an invitation, GO.
